Dr Caroline Chung

Dr Caroline Chung is passionate about managing the oral health of children, and as a paediatric dental specialist, routinely treats children with anxiety and special needs. She also has a special interest in managing developmental defects in teeth, or “chalky” teeth, early childhood caries, oral surgery, and dental trauma.
Dr Caroline Chung completed her Bachelor of Dental Surgery degree from the University of Sydney in 2003. She went on to complete her Primary Examinations with the Royal Australasian College of Dental Surgeons.
Caroline then continued her studies abroad at the University of Hong Kong, and completed a Master of Dental Surgery specialising in paediatric dentistry, and an Advanced Diploma in Paediatric Dentistry in 2009.
Dr Caroline also has current memberships with the Australasian Academy of Paediatric Dentistry, the Australian and New Zealand Society of Paediatric Dentistry, the Royal Australasian College of Dental Surgeons and the Royal College of Surgeons Edinburgh.
